Rectangular Connectors - Headers, Receptacles, Female Sockets

Rectangular Connectors are electrical connectors typically used in a wide range of applications, from consumer electronics to industrial machinery. Included in the vast range of these connectors are headers, receptacles, and female sockets. This article will discuss the various industrial applications and the underlying working principles of specifically the414-43-264-41-117000 model of rectangular connectors. Headers, commonly used on printed circuit boards within commercial electronic equipment, are rectangular connectors which contain two or more electrical contacts in a row. These contacts, referred to as pins, are connected to a mating connector via a wire, a printed circuit board, or some other mating connection device. Generally, their main purpose is to provide electrical connections between circuit board components and other electronic components or systems. Receptacles, also known as plugs or plugs and sockets, are devices used to connect a device\'s plug to its matching socket. They define the physical characteristics of a cable or connector interface, including the identification of contacts, their positions, and the number, type, and arrangement of sockets. They come in a variety of shapes, sizes, and designs to suit different applications.Female sockets, or composite connectors, are connectors featuring a number of female contacts, typically arranged in a single row. They are easy to install and remove and present a flat, low-profile packaging option for many applications. Generally, they are used to join two electrical connections together, and can even join two dissimilar circuits.
